Optimizing the Volvo EC210 VECU for Optimal Excavator Control

To unlock the full potential of your Volvo EC210 excavator, knowing its sophisticated VECU system is paramount. The VECU, or Vehicle Electronic Control Unit, acts as the central processor behind your machine's performance, regulating everything from engine output to hydraulic functions. By becoming acquainted with its intricacies and leveraging its capabilities, operators can achieve optimized control and efficiency. This includes modifying parameters like reaction speeds to suit individual needs. Furthermore, regular analysis of VECU data provides valuable insights into the excavator's health and performance, enabling preventative care and ultimately extending its lifespan.

Dissecting Volvo's EC210 VECU: Troubleshooting and Repair Tips

Diving into the complexities of a Volvo EC210 excavator's Electrical Control Unit (VECU) can seem daunting. This vital component orchestrates numerous functions, from hydraulic movements to engine performance. Understanding its structure and common issues is key for effective troubleshooting and repair. Initiate by familiarizing yourself with the VECU's location within the excavator's frame. Inspecting its connectors for any wear is crucial. Typical problems include faulty sensors, communication errors between modules, and software glitches.

Remember, working on the VECU can be intricate. If you lack experience, it's best to engage a qualified technician. Their expertise can ensure a safe and effective repair.
